示例库:ms-identity-macOS-swift-objcapp似乎没有从MSGraph中 "导入 "头文件就使用了MSGraph。 唯一的导入是 "MSAL"......。我不明白这个问题,MSAL是否提供对MSGraph的访问? MSAL是否提供了对MSGraph的访问,而没有进一步的操作。我需要读取邮箱设置并创建新的联系人。 我需要导入MSGraph吗? 是否有相关的文档我应该阅读?
在这里谢谢你的任何想法!Steve
这就是你要找的东西 - Microsoft Graph SDK for ObjC。https:/github.commicrosoftgraphmsgraph-sdk-objc。
每一次对Microsoft Graph的网络调用都需要经过认证。为此,创建 MSHTTPClient 实例需要将 MSAuthenticationProvider 协议的实例作为参数。
您可以通过两种方式创建MSAuthenticationProvider实例。
使用MSGraphMSALAuthProvider这个Repo通过MSAL来处理认证场景----------。https:/github.commicrosoftgraphmsgraph-sdk-objc-auth。
通过编写你自己的MSAuthenticationProvider的内涵。